S/SGT ALVIN HEDRICK ENTERED THE SERVICE ON 20 JUL 1942. HE ATTENDED AAF TECHINICAL TRAINING AT BRIGGS MANUFACTURING COMPANY IN DETROIT, BUCKLEY FIELD AND LOWRY FIELDS IN COLORADO. ON 10 MAR 1944 S/SGT HEDRICK ARRIVED IN ITALY AND WAS ASSIGNED TO THE 772ND BOMB SQUADRON, 463RD BOMB GROUP, 15TH AIR FORCE WHERE HE SERVED UNTIL 17 SEPTEMBER 1945. ON 8 OCTOBER 1945 S/SGT HEDRICK WAS HONORABLY DISCHARGED AT FORT MEADE, MARYLAND. ALVIN HEDRICK PASSED AWAY IN ROMNEY, WV ON 30 SEPTEMBER 1969 AND WAS LAID TO REST AT THE FLANAGAN HILL CEMETERY NEAR WHERE HE WAS BORN IN RED CREEK, TUCKER COUNTY, WV

Description (Southern France Campaign 15 August to 14 September 1944) While the Germans were retreating in Italy in the summer of 1944, the Allies diverted some of their strength in the theater to the invasion of Southern France. After preliminary bombardment, a combined seaborne-airborne force landed on the French Riviera on 15 August. Marseilles having been taken, Sevmth Army advanced up the Rhone Valley and by mid-September was in touch with Allied forces that had entered France from the north.
